A look back at the Marlins last firesale:

11/11/97: Traded Moises Alou to the Houston Astros. Received a player to be named later, Manuel Barrios, and Oscar Henriquez. The Houston Astros sent Mark J. Johnson (December 16, 1997) to the Florida Marlins to complete the trade.

11/18/97: Traded Robb Nen to the San Francisco Giants. Received Joe Fontenot, Mike Pageler (minors), and Mike Villano (minors).

Traded Devon White to the Arizona Diamondbacks. Received Jesus Martinez (minors).

11/20/97: Traded Jeff Conine to the Kansas City Royals. Received Blaine Mull (minors).

Traded Ed Vosberg to the San Diego Padres. Received Chris Clark (minors).

12/15/97: Traded Kevin Brown to the San Diego Padres. Received Derrek Lee, Rafael Medina, and Steve Hoff (minors).

12/18/97: Traded Dennis Cook to the New York Mets. Received Fletcher Bates (minors) and Scott Comer (minors).

12/19/97: Traded Kurt Abbott to the Oakland Athletics. Received Eric Ludwick.

2/6/98: Traded Al Leiter and Ralph Milliard to the New York Mets. Received A.J. Burnett, Jesus Sanchez, and Robert Stratton (minors).

5/14/98: Traded Manuel Barrios, Bobby Bonilla, Jim Eisenreich, Charles Johnson, and Gary Sheffield to the Los Angeles Dodgers. Received Mike Piazza and Todd Zeile

5/22/98: Traded Mike Piazza to the New York Mets. Received Preston Wilson, Ed Yarnall, and Geoff Goetz (minors).

7/4/98: Traded Jay Powell and Scott Makarewicz (minors) to the Houston Astros. Received Ramon Castro.

7/31/98: Traded Todd Zeile to the Texas Rangers. Received Daniel DeYoung (minors) and Jose Santo (minors).

Traded Felix Heredia and Steve Hoff (minors) to the Chicago Cubs. Received Justin Speier, Kevin Orie, and Todd Noel (minors).




Looking at what the Marlins got back, the most significant players were Burnett, Lee, Wilson, and Ramon Castro. Makes you wonder if this firesale will give them better results?


Posted


Also makes you think twice before just assuming the success of the always popular 'trade em all for prospects' method of team building.
Not only did most of those trades receive little in return but -- unlike most "dump 'em" strategies -- many of the players traded were dealt at or near the height of their careers and presumably their fetching power: Brown, Alou, Sheffield/Piazza, Nen.
